Established in 1996 and rebranded to Scout in 2024, we built our foundation on planning meetings for numerous organizations within the life sciences sector (Scout Meetings). In response to emerging industry needs, we expanded our services to include Scout Clinical, one of the top providers of clinical trial patient travel and reimbursements, and Scout Academy, our secure, online, on-demand learning management system that ensures global compliance. Scout is recognized as a leader in our field for innovation in service, attention to detail, our stellar team members, and making the complex easier. Position Summary: We are seeking a detail-oriented and reliableData Entry Specialistto support our clinical operations team by entering and maintaining accurate data in theScout portal. This is a remote 1099 contract role anticipated to last 6 months with approximately 40 hours each week. It is ideal for someone who is organized, self-motivated, and comfortable working independently.The specialist will play a key role in tracking progress and ensuring data integrity across operational workflows.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Accurately enter data into the Scout portal based on provided documentation and source materials.

  • Monitor and track progress of data entries to ensure completeness and timeliness.

  • Perform regular audits to verify data accuracy and resolve discrepancies.

  • Collaborate with team members to ensure alignment on data requirements and timelines.

  • Maintain confidentiality and security of sensitive information.

  • Generate basic reports or summaries from the portal as needed.

The ideal candidate will have the following experience, skills, and knowledge:

  • High school diploma or equivalent; associate degree preferred.

  • Proven experience in data entry or administrative support roles.

The ideal candidate will have the following competencies and qualities:

  • Strong attention to detail and organizational skills.

  • Proficiency with data entry software and systems; experience with Scout portal is a plus.

  • Ability to work independently in a remote environment and manage time effectively.

  • Excellent communication skills.

  • Familiarity with clinical operations or healthcare data preferred.

  • Experience with tracking tools or project management systems preferred.
